Remembering Ronnie Bowman: A Tragic Loss for the Country Music Community

The country music community is mourning the loss of talented singer and musician Ronnie Bowman, who tragically passed away at the age of 64. According to reports from Taste of Country, Bowman lost his life on Sunday, March 22, following a fatal motorcycle accident in Ashland City that occurred the day before.

Hailing from Mount Airy, North Carolina, Bowman’s musical journey began in childhood, singing gospel music and performing in a family band. Over the years, he would establish himself as a highly respected musician, songwriter, and bluegrass singer, gaining recognition for his work with the Lonesome River Band, which he joined in 1982.

Throughout his career, Bowman released several acclaimed solo albums, including 1994’s Cold Virginia Night, which earned him an IBMA Bluegrass Music Award for Album of the Year in 1995. His other solo works include The Man I’m Tryin’ To Be (1998), Starting Over (2002), It’s Gettin’ Better All the Time (2005), and his self-titled album Ronnie Bowman in 2019.

In addition to his solo success, Bowman was a three-time IBMA Male Vocalist of the Year, winning the title in 1995, 1998, and 1999, solidifying his influence in the bluegrass genre. He also made his mark as a songwriter, co-writing hits for country music stars like Lee Ann Womack, Kenny Chesney, Jake Owen, Chris Stapleton, Brooks & Dunn, and many others.

While Bowman’s family has not issued a public statement, fellow country music artists have taken to social media to express their grief over his passing. Dierks Bentley reminisced about the good times spent with Bowman, fondly recalling his favorite bluegrass and country singer. Alison Krauss described Bowman as a joy to know, and Rhonda Vincent praised him for his talent and kindness.

James Otto also expressed his condolences, highlighting Bowman’s beloved status within the songwriting community and urging fans to keep his wife and family in their thoughts.

Details surrounding Bowman’s tragic accident have yet to be disclosed, leaving fans and the music industry devastated by the loss of such a talented and respected artist.
